 2.  A soup or stew thickened with okra pods. Also called  okra.
3.  Chiefly Mississippi Valley & Western US   A fine silty soil, common in the southern and western United States, that forms an unusually sticky mud when wet.
4.   Gumbo A French patois spoken by some black people and Creoles in Louisiana and the French West Indies.
